Android 中Volley二次封装并实现网络请求缓存

Android目前很多同学使用Volley请求网络数据,但是Volley没有对请求过得数据进行缓存,因此需要我们自己手动缓存。 一下就是我的一种思路,仅供参考

具体使用方法为:

代码语言:javascript
复制
HashMap<String,String  params = new HashMap< ();
params.put("id", "1");
params.put("user", "mcoy");
new NetWorkHelper(getActivity()).jacksonMethodRequest
("method_id", params, new TypeReference<ReturnTemple<FirstCategories  (){}, handler, msgId);

NetWorkHelper—对Volley的封装,首先调用CacheManager.get(methodName, params);方法获取缓存中的数据,如果数据为null,

则继续发送网络请求。

代码语言:javascript
复制
/** 
* @version V1.0 网络请求帮助类 
* @author: mcoy 
*/ 
public final class NetWorkHelper { 
private NetWorkManager netWorkUtils; 
public NetWorkHelper(Context context){ 
netWorkUtils = new NetWorkManager(context); 
} 
public static final String COMMON_ERROR_MSG = "连接超时,请稍后重试"; 
public static final int COMMON_ERROR_CODE = 2; 
/** 
* 使用Jackson请求的方法 
* @param methodName 
* @param params 
* @param handler 
* @param msgId 
*/ 
public void jacksonMethodRequest(final String methodName,final HashMap<String,String  params,TypeReference javaType, final Handler handler,final int msgId){ 
ResponseListener listener =  new ResponseListener(){ 
@Override 
public void onResponse(Object response, boolean isCache) { 
PrintLog.log(response.toString()); 
if (isCache){ 
CacheManager.put(methodName, params, response); 
} 
if (handler != null) { 
Message message = handler.obtainMessage(); 
message.what = msgId; 
message.obj = response; 
handler.sendMessage(message); 
} 
} 
}; 
Object respone = CacheManager.get(methodName, params); 
if(respone != null){ 
listener.onResponse(respone,false); 
return; 
} 
HashMap<String,String  allParams = Config.setSign(true); 
allParams.putAll(params); 
Response.ErrorListener errorListener = new Response.ErrorListener() { 
@Override 
public void onErrorResponse(VolleyError error) { 
error.printStackTrace(); 
if (handler != null) { 
Message message = handler.obtainMessage(); 
message.what = msgId; 
message.obj = COMMON_ERROR_MSG; 
handler.sendMessage(message); 
} 
} 
}; 
netWorkUtils.jacksonRequest(getUrl(methodName), allParams,javaType, listener, errorListener); 
} 
/** 
* Url直接请求 
* @param url 
* @param params 
* @param handler 
* @param msgId 
*/ 
public void urlRequest(String url,HashMap<String,String  params,JsonParser jsonParser,final Handler handler,final int msgId){ 
request(url, true, params, jsonParser, handler, msgId); 
} 
/** 
* 通过方法请求 
* @param methodName 方法名 
* @param params 请求参数 
* @param jsonParser Json解析器 
* @param handler 回调通知 
* @param msgId 通知的Id 
*/ 
public void methodRequest(String methodName, final HashMap<String,String  params,final JsonParser jsonParser,final Handler handler,final int msgId){ 
request(getUrl(methodName),true,params,jsonParser,handler,msgId); 
} 
/** 
* 通过方法请求 
* @param methodName 方法名 
* @param params 请求参数 
* @param jsonParser Json解析器 
* @param handler 回调通知 
* @param msgId 通知的Id 
*/ 
public void methodRequest(String methodName, boolean isLogin,final HashMap<String,String  params,final JsonParser jsonParser,final Handler handler,final int msgId){ 
request(getUrl(methodName),isLogin,params,jsonParser,handler,msgId); 
} 
private void request(final String url, boolean isLogin,final HashMap<String,String  params,final JsonParser jsonParser,final Handler handler,final int msgId){ 
final HashMap<String,String  allParams = Config.setSign(isLogin); 
allParams.putAll(params); 
Response.Listener listener = new Response.Listener<String () { 
@Override 
public void onResponse(String response) { 
/** 
* 有些请求默认是没有parser传过来的,出参只求String,譬如联合登录等 
* 所以加了一个else if 
*/ 
Object result; 
PrintLog.log(response); 
if (jsonParser != null ) { 
jsonParser.json2Obj(response); 
jsonParser.temple.description = jsonParser.temple.getResultDescription(); 
result = jsonParser.temple; 
} else { 
ReturnTemple temple = new ReturnTemple(); 
temple.issuccessful = false; 
temple.description = COMMON_ERROR_MSG; 
temple.result = -100; 
result = temple; 
} 
if (handler != null) { 
Message message = handler.obtainMessage(); 
message.what = msgId; 
message.obj = result; 
handler.sendMessage(message); 
} 
} 
}; 
Response.ErrorListener errorListener = new Response.ErrorListener() { 
@Override 
public void onErrorResponse(VolleyError error) { 
Object result; 
if (jsonParser != null) { 
ReturnTemple temple = new ReturnTemple(); 
temple.issuccessful = false; 
temple.description = COMMON_ERROR_MSG; 
temple.result = COMMON_ERROR_CODE; 
result = temple; 
} else { 
result = COMMON_ERROR_MSG; 
} 
if (handler != null) { 
Message message = handler.obtainMessage(); 
message.what = msgId; 
message.obj = result; 
handler.sendMessage(message); 
} 
} 
}; 
netWorkUtils.request(url, allParams, listener, errorListener); 
} 
/** 
* 根据访求名拼装请求的Url 
* @param methodName 
* @return 
*/ 
private String getUrl(String methodName){ 
String url = Config.getUrl(); 
if (!StringUtil.isNullOrEmpty(methodName)) { 
url = url + "?method=" + methodName; 
} 
return url; 
} 
} 

CacheManager—将针对某一method所请求的数据缓存到本地文件当中,主要是将CacheRule写到本地文件当中

代码语言:javascript
复制
/** 
* @version V1.0 <缓存管理  
* @author: mcoy 
*/ 
public final class CacheManager { 
/** 
* 一个方法对应的多个Key,比如分类都是同一个方法,但是请求会不一样,可能都要缓存 
*/ 
private static HashMap<String, ArrayList<String   methodKeys; 
private static final String keyFileName = "keys.pro"; 
/** 
* 读取缓存的Key 
*/ 
public static void readCacheKey() { 
methodKeys = (HashMap<String, ArrayList<String  ) readObject(keyFileName); 
if (methodKeys == null) { 
methodKeys = new HashMap<String, ArrayList<String  (); 
} 
} 
/** 
* 保存缓存 
*/ 
public static void put(String method, HashMap<String, String  params, Object object) { 
long expireTime = CacheConfig.getExpireTime(method); 
if (expireTime <= 0 || methodKeys == null) {//有效时间小于0,则不需要缓存 
return; 
} 
String key = createKey(method, params); 
if (methodKeys.containsKey(method)) { 
ArrayList<String  keys = methodKeys.get(method); 
keys.add(key); 
} else { 
ArrayList<String  keys = new ArrayList< (); 
keys.add(key); 
methodKeys.put(method, keys); 
} 
writeObject(methodKeys, keyFileName); 
String fileName = key + ".pro"; 
CacheRule cacheRule = new CacheRule(expireTime, object); 
LogModel.log(" put " + method + " " + key + " " + cacheRule); 
writeObject(cacheRule, fileName); 
} 
public static Object get(String method, HashMap<String, String  params) { 
long expireTime = CacheConfig.getExpireTime(method); 
if (expireTime <= 0 || methodKeys == null || !methodKeys.containsKey(method)) {//有效时间小于0,则不需要缓存 
return null; 
} 
ArrayList<String  keys = methodKeys.get(method); 
//    String saveKey = keys.get(method); 
String key = createKey(method, params); 
String fileName = key + ".pro"; 
//    LogModel.log("get"+method+" "+(saveKey.equals(key))+" path:"+fileName); 
CacheRule cacheRule = null; 
try { 
if (keys.contains(key)) { 
cacheRule = (CacheRule) readObject(fileName); 
} 
} catch (Exception e) { 
e.printStackTrace(); 
} 
LogModel.log("get :" + method + " " + key + " " + cacheRule); 
if (cacheRule != null && cacheRule.isExpire()) { 
return cacheRule.getData(); 
} else { 
return null; 
} 
} 
public static void main(String[] args) { 
String method = "category.getCategory"; 
HashMap<String, String  params = new HashMap< (); 
params.put("categoryId", "-3"); 
System.out.println(createKey(method, params)); 
System.out.println(CacheRule.getCurrentTime()); 
} 
/** 
* 生成Key 
* 
* @param method 请求的方法名 
* @param params 私有参数(除公共参数以外的参数) 
* @return 
*/ 
private static String createKey(String method, HashMap<String, String  params) { 
try { 
MessageDigest digest = MessageDigest.getInstance("md5"); 
digest.digest(method.getBytes("UTF-8")); 
StringBuilder builder = new StringBuilder(method); 
if (params != null && params.size()   0) { 
Iterator<Map.Entry<String, String   iterator = params.entrySet().iterator(); 
while (iterator.hasNext()) { 
Map.Entry<String, String  entry = iterator.next(); 
builder.append(entry.getKey()).append("=").append(entry.getValue()); 
} 
} 
byte[] tempArray = digest.digest(builder.toString().getBytes("UTF-8")); 
StringBuffer keys = new StringBuffer(); 
for (byte b : tempArray) { 
// 与运算 
int number = b & 0xff;// 加盐 
String str = Integer.toHexString(number); 
// System.out.println(str); 
if (str.length() == 1) { 
keys.append("0"); 
} 
keys.append(str); 
} 
return keys.toString().toUpperCase(); 
} catch (Exception e) { 
e.printStackTrace(); 
} 
return method.toUpperCase(); 
} 
/** 
* 将对象写到文件中 
* 
* @param object 
* @param fileName 
*/ 
private static void writeObject(Object object, String fileName) { 
try { 
ObjectOutputStream oo = new ObjectOutputStream(new FileOutputStream(new File(CacheConfig.getCachePath() + fileName))); 
oo.writeObject(object); 
oo.close(); 
} catch (IOException e) { 
e.printStackTrace(); 
} 
} 
/** 
* 读取对象 
* 
* @param fileName 
* @return 
*/ 
private static Object readObject(String fileName) { 
Object result = null; 
try { 
File file = new File(CacheConfig.getCachePath() + fileName); 
if (file.exists()) { 
ObjectInputStream oi = new ObjectInputStream(new FileInputStream(file)); 
result = oi.readObject(); 
oi.close(); 
} 
} catch (Exception e) { 
e.printStackTrace(); 
} 
return result; 
} 
} 

CacheConfig—初始化哪些方法需要做缓存处理,以及缓存的有效时间

代码语言:javascript
复制
/** 
* @version V1.0 <设置哪些类数据需要缓存  
* @author: mcoy 
*/ 
public final class CacheConfig { 
/**方法对应的缓存有效时间,时间是毫秒*/ 
private static HashMap<String,Long  methodExpireTimes = new HashMap<String, Long (); 
private static String cachePath = null; 
static { 
methodExpireTimes.put(ConstMethod.GET_CATEGORY_LIST,30 * 60 * 1000L); 
methodExpireTimes.put(ConstMethod.GET_NEW_CATEGORY_LIST,30 * 60 * 1000L); 
} 
/** 
* 初始化缓存路径 
* @param context 
*/ 
public static void init(Context context){ 
cachePath = context.getFilesDir().getPath()+ File.separator+"cache"+File.separator; 
File file = new File(cachePath); 
if(!file.exists()){ 
file.mkdirs(); 
} 
CacheManager.readCacheKey(); 
} 
/**缓存路径*/ 
public static String getCachePath() { 
return cachePath; 
} 
/** 
* 获取有方法对应的有效时间,如果方法没有添加缓存或者缓存时间小于0,则不添加缓存 
* @param method 
* @return 
*/ 
public static long getExpireTime(String method){ 
if(methodExpireTimes.containsKey(method)){ 
return methodExpireTimes.get(method); 
}else { 
return -1; 
} 
} 
} 

CacheRule—主要有两个参数,expireTime需要缓存的时间, data需要缓存的数据

代码语言:javascript
复制
public class CacheRule implements Serializable{ 
/** 有效时间 */ 
public long expireTime; 
/** 缓存时间*/ 
public long cacheTime; 
/** 缓存数据 */ 
private Object data; 
public CacheRule(long expireTime,Object data){ 
cacheTime = getCurrentTime(); 
this.expireTime = expireTime; 
this.data = data; 
} 
public Object getData() { 
return data; 
} 
public void setData(Object data) { 
this.data = data; 
} 
@Override 
public int hashCode() { 
return BeanTools.createHashcode(expireTime, cacheTime, data); 
} 
@Override 
public String toString() { 
StringBuilder builder = new StringBuilder(); 
builder.append("expireTime:").append(expireTime).append(" cacheTime:").append(cacheTime) 
.append(" curTime:").append(getCurrentTime()) 
.append(" isExpire:").append(isExpire()).append(" data:").append(data==null?"null":data.toString()); 
return builder.toString(); 
} 
/** 
* 数据是否有效 
* @return 
*/ 
public boolean isExpire(){ 
long curTime = getCurrentTime(); 
return curTime (expireTime+cacheTime)?false:true; 
} 
/** 
* 获取当前时间 
* @return 
*/ 
public static long getCurrentTime(){ 
//    if (Build.VERSION_CODES.JELLY_BEAN_MR1 <= Build.VERSION.SDK_INT) { 
//      return SystemClock.elapsedRealtimeNanos(); 
//    } else { 
return System.currentTimeMillis(); 
//    } 
} 
} 

NetWorkManager—往RequestQueue中添加JacksonRequest请求,然后Volley会去请求数据

代码语言:javascript
复制
/** 
* 网络请求的工具类 
*/ 
public final class NetWorkManager { 
private RequestQueue requestQueue ; 
public NetWorkManager(Context context){ 
requestQueue = Volley.newRequestQueue(context); 
} 
/** 
* 使用Jackson解析请求的方法 
* @param url 
* @param params 
* @param javaType 成功时返回的Java类型 
* @param listener 
* @param errorListener 
*/ 
public void jacksonRequest(final String url,final HashMap<String,String  params,TypeReference javaType, ResponseListener listener, Response.ErrorListener errorListener){ 
JacksonRequest jacksonRequest = new JacksonRequest(url,javaType,params,listener,errorListener); 
requestQueue.add(jacksonRequest); 
} 
/** 
* 普通的网络请求,返回的Json 
* @param url 
* @param params 
* @param listener 
* @param errorListener 
*/ 
public void request(final String url,final HashMap<String,String  params,Response.Listener listener,Response.ErrorListener errorListener){ 
StringRequest stringRequest = new StringRequest(Request.Method.POST,url,listener,errorListener){ 
@Override 
protected Map<String, String  getParams() throws AuthFailureError { 
if (PrintLog.DEBUG) { 
Iterator<Map.Entry<String,String   iterator = params.entrySet().iterator(); 
StringBuilder builder = new StringBuilder(url+" "); 
while (iterator.hasNext()){ 
Map.Entry<String,String  entry = iterator.next(); 
builder.append(entry.getKey()+":"+entry.getValue()).append("; "); 
} 
PrintLog.log(builder.toString()); 
} 
return params; 
} 
}; 
requestQueue.add(stringRequest); 
} 
} 

JacksonRequest—继承Request,重写deliverResponse方法,并调用ResponseListener的onResponse方法,并通过CacheManager.put(methodName, params, response);将获取的response缓存到CacheManager中。这一步很重要,调用我们自己的listener,而不是Volley提供给我们的Response.Listener

代码语言:javascript
复制
/** 
* Created by mcoy 
*/ 
public class JacksonRequest extends Request { 
private final HashMap<String,String  params; 
private final ResponseListener listener; 
private final ObjectMapper mapper; 
private final TypeReference javaType; 
public JacksonRequest(String url,TypeReference javaType,HashMap<String,String  params,ResponseListener listener,Response.ErrorListener errorListener){ 
super(Method.POST,url,errorListener); 
mapper = new ObjectMapper(); 
mapper.configure(JsonParser.Feature.ALLOW_SINGLE_QUOTES,true); 
mapper.configure(DeserializationFeature.FAIL_ON_UNKNOWN_PROPERTIES, false); 
this.params = params; 
this.listener = listener; 
this.javaType = javaType; 
} 
@Override 
protected Map<String, String  getParams() throws AuthFailureError { 
return params; 
} 
@Override 
protected Response parseNetworkResponse(NetworkResponse response) { 
String json; 
try { 
json = new String(response.data, HttpHeaderParser.parseCharset(response.headers)); 
PrintLog.log("返回的json:" + json); 
return Response.success(mapper.readValue(json,javaType), HttpHeaderParser.parseCacheHeaders(response)); 
}catch (UnsupportedEncodingException e){ 
json = new String(response.data); 
PrintLog.log("json:"+json); 
try { 
return Response.success(mapper.readValue(json,javaType),HttpHeaderParser.parseCacheHeaders(response)); 
} catch (IOException e1) { 
return Response.error(new ParseError(e)); 
} 
} catch (JsonParseException e) { 
PrintLog.log(e.toString()); 
return Response.error(new ParseError(e)); 
} catch (JsonMappingException e) {PrintLog.log(e.toString()); 
return Response.error(new ParseError(e)); 
} catch (IOException e) {PrintLog.log(e.toString()); 
return Response.error(new ParseError(e)); 
} 
} 
@Override 
protected void deliverResponse(Object response) { 
listener.onResponse(response,true); 
} 
} 

ResponseListener—自定义的一个listener接口, 在发送请求时,需要将其实现。其中才参数中比Volley的提供的listener过了一个isCache的Boolean值,根据此值来决定是否要缓存。

代码语言:javascript
复制
/** 
* @version V1.0 <描述当前版本功能  
* @author: mcoy 
*/ 
public interface ResponseListener<T  { 
public void onResponse(T response, boolean isCache); 
}
